Clinical and surgical outcome in patients with cervical spondylodiscitis-a single-center retrospective case series of 24 patients. Front Surg 2024; 11:1292977. Abstract
Objective Cervical spondylodiscitis is a rare pathology, with an incidence of 0.5-2.5 per 100,000 population, posing significant potential risks. This type of infection can lead to neurological impairment in up to 29% of patients. Radical surgical debridement of the infected segment, fusion, and an intravenous antibiotic regimen remains the gold standard in most spine centers. This study aimed to analyze the surgical outcome in a tertiary spine center based on disease severity. Methods In this study, we retrospectively included all patients diagnosed with cervical spondylodiscitis and treated at the University Hospital Augsburg between January 2017 and May 2022. We collected and analyzed baseline parameters on clinical presentation with symptoms, laboratory parameters, radiological appearance, and surgical parameters such as type of approach and implant, as well as neurological and radiological outcomes. Descriptive statistics were performed using SPSS, and relevant correlations were examined using the t-test for independent samples and the chi-square test. Results Twenty-four patients (9%) with cervical spondylodiscitis were identified. Twenty-two (92%) surgically treated patients were subdivided into the complicated discitis group (n = 14, 64%) and the uncomplicated discitis group (n = 8, 36%). Seventeen patients (71%) presented with sepsis on admission, 17 patients (71%) were diagnosed with epidural abscess on primary imaging, and 5 patients (21%) had more than one discitis lesion at a distant spinal segment. The presence of epidural abscess was significantly associated with systemic sepsis (OR = 6.2; p = 0.03) and myelopathy symptoms (OR = 14.4; p = 0.00). The most frequently detected specimen was a multisensitive Staphylococcus aureus (10 patients, 42%). Six patients (25%) died after a median of 20 days despite antibiogram-accurate therapy, five of whom were diagnosed with a complicated type of discitis. The follow-up data of 15 patients (63%) revealed permanent neurological damage in 9 patients (38%). Notably, the surgical approach was a significant factor for revision surgery (p = 0.008), as three out of five (60%) ventrodorsal cases with complicated discitis were revised. Conclusion Cervical spondylodiscitis represents a severe infectious disease that is often associated with permanent neurological damage or a fatal outcome, despite adequate surgical and antibiotic treatments. Complicated types of discitis may require a more challenging surgical and clinical course.

Midterm survival and risk factor analysis in patients with pyogenic vertebral osteomyelitis: a retrospective study of 155 cases. Front Surg 2024; 11:1357318. Abstract
Background Pyogenic vertebral osteomyelitis (VO) represents a clinical challenge and is linked to substantial morbidity and mortality. This study aimed to examine mortality as well as potential risk factors contributing to in-hospital mortality among patients with VO. Methods This retrospective analysis involved patients receiving treatment for VO at University Regensburg in Germany from January 1, 2000, to December 3, 2020. It included in-hospital mortality rate, comorbidities and pathogens. Patients were identified using ICD-10 diagnosis codes: M46.2, M46.3, M46.4, and M46.5. Kaplan-Meier probability plots and odds ratios (OR) for mortality were calculated. Results Out of the total cohort of 155 patients with VO, 53 patients (34.1%) died during a mean follow-up time of 87.8 ± 70.8 months. The overall mortality was 17.2% at one year, 19.9% at two years and 28.3% at five years. Patients with congestive heart failure (p = 0.005), renal disease (p < 0.001), symptoms of paraplegia (p = 0.029), and sepsis (p = 0.006) demonstrated significantly higher overall mortality rates. In 56.1% of cases, pathogens were identified, with Staphylococcus aureus (S. aureus) and other unidentified pathogens being the most common. Renal disease (OR 1.85) and congestive heart failure (OR 1.52) were identified as significant risk factors. Conclusion Early assessment of the specific risk factors for each patient may prove beneficial in the management and treatment of VO to reduce the risk of mortality. These findings demonstrate the importance of close monitoring of VO patients with underlying chronic organ disease and early identification and treatment of sepsis. Prioritizing identification of the exact pathogens and antibiotic sensitivity testing can improve outcomes for patients in this high-risk group.

Brucellar, Pyogenic, and Tuberculous Spondylodiscitis at Tertiary Hospitals in Saudi Arabia: A Comparative Retrospective Cohort Study. Open Forum Infect Dis 2023; 10:ofad453. Abstract
Introduction Spondylodiscitis is rare yet the most common form of spinal infection. It is characterized by inflammation of the intervertebral disk space and adjacent vertebral body. In Western countries, the incidence of spondylodiscitis is increasing. Clinical outcomes most commonly reported in the literature are the 1-year mortality rate (range, 6%-12%) and neurologic deficits. Methods This multicenter retrospective cohort study assessed patients diagnosed with infectious spondylodiscitis who received treatment at King Abdulaziz Medical City in Riyadh and Jeddah, Saudi Arabia. All enrolled patients were ≥18 years old and were diagnosed per radiologic and microbiological findings and clinical manifestations between January 2017 and November 2021. Results This study enrolled 76 patients with infectious spondylodiscitis, with a median age of 61 years. All patients presented with back pain for a median 30 days. Patients were stratified into 3 groups based on the causative pathogen: brucellar spondylodiscitis (n = 52), tuberculous spondylodiscitis (n = 13), and pyogenic spondylodiscitis (n = 11). All laboratory data and biochemical markers were not significantly different. However, C-reactive protein, erythrocyte sedimentation rate, and white blood cells were significantly different in the pyogenic spondylodiscitis group, with medians of 121 mg/dL (P = .03), 82 mmol/h (P = .04), and 11.2 × 109/L (P = .014), respectively. Conclusions Back pain is a common clinical feature associated with infectious spondylodiscitis. The immense value of microbiological investigations accompanied with histologic studies in determining the causative pathogen cannot be emphasized enough. Treatment with prolonged intravenous antimicrobial therapy with surgical intervention in some cases produced a cure rate exceeding 60%.

Lawson McLean A, Senft C, Schwarz F. Management of Lumbar Pyogenic Spondylodiscitis in Germany: A Cross-Sectional Analysis of Spine Specialists. World Neurosurg 2023; 173:e663-e668. Abstract
OBJECTIVE The incidence of pyogenic spondylodiscitis is increasing, and the disease is associated with considerable morbidity, mortality, long-term healthcare utilization and societal costs. Disease-specific treatment guidelines are lacking and there is little consensus regarding optimal conservative and surgical management. This cross-sectional survey of German specialist spinal surgeons sought to determine practice patterns and degree of consensus regarding the management of lumbar pyogenic spondylodiscitis (LPS). METHODS An electronic survey covering provider information, diagnostic approaches, treatment algorithms, and follow-up care of patients with LPS was distributed to members of the German Spine Society. RESULTS Seventy-nine survey responses were included in the analysis. Magnetic resonance imaging is the diagnostic imaging modality of choice for 87% of respondents; 100% routinely measure C-reactive protein in suspected LPS and 70% routinely take blood cultures before therapy initiation; 41% believe that surgical biopsy to obtain microbiological diagnosis should be carried out in all cases of suspected LPS, whereas 23% believe that surgical biopsy should only be carried out when empirical antibiotic therapy proves ineffective; 38% believe an intraspinal empyema should always be surgically evacuated, regardless of spinal cord compression. The median intravenous antibiotic duration is 2 weeks. The median total duration of the antibiotic therapy (intravenous and oral) is 8 weeks. Magnetic resonance imaging is the preferred imaging modality for follow-up of both conservatively and operatively treated LPS. CONCLUSIONS There exists considerable variation of care in the diagnosis, management, and follow-up of LPS among German spine specialists with little agreement on key aspects of care. Further research is required to understand this variation in clinical practice and to enhance the evidence base in LPS.

Heuer A, Strahl A, Viezens L, Koepke LG, Stangenberg M, Dreimann M. The Hamburg Spondylodiscitis Assessment Score (HSAS) for Immediate Evaluation of Mortality Risk on Hospital Admission. J Clin Med 2022; 11:jcm11030660. Abstract
(1) Background: Patients with spondylodiscitis often present with unspecific and heterogeneous symptoms that delay diagnosis and inevitable therapeutic steps leading to increased mortality rates of up to 27%. A rapid initial triage is essential to identify patients at risk for a complicative disease course. We therefore aimed to develop a risk assessment score using fast available parameters to predict in-hospital mortality of patients admitted with spondylodiscitis. (2) Methods: A retrospective data analysis of 307 patients with spondylodiscitis recruited from 2013 to 2020 was carried out. Patients were grouped according to all-cause mortality. Via logistic regression, individual patient and clinical characteristics predictive of mortality were identified. A weighted sum score to estimate a patient's risk of mortality was developed and validated in a randomly selected subgroup of spondylodiscitis patients. (3) Results: 14% of patients with spondylodiscitis died during their in-hospital stay at a tertiary center for spinal surgery. Univariate and logistic regression analyses of parameters recorded at hospital admission showed that age older than 72.5 years, rheumatoid arthritis, creatinine > 1.29 mg/dL and CRP > 140.5 mg/L increased the risk of mortality 3.9-fold, 9.4-fold, 4.3-fold and 4.1-fold, respectively. S. aureus detection increased the risk of mortality by 2.3-fold. (4) Conclusions: The novel Hamburg Spondylodiscitis Assessment Score (HSAS) shows a good fit identifying patients at low-, moderate-, high- and very high risk for in hospital mortality on admission (AUC: 0.795; p < 0.001). The implementation of the HSAS into clinical practice could ease identification of high-risk patients using readily available parameters alone, improving the patient's safety and outcome.

Yaw Tee LY, Hunter S, Baker JF. BMP use in the surgical treatment of pyogenic spondylodiscitis: Is it safe? J Clin Neurosci 2021; 95:94-98. Abstract
OBJECTIVE Use of BMP in the setting of infection remains controversial. We examined the safety and effectiveness of BMP in the surgical treatment of pyogenic spondylodiscitis and compared patients who have been treated with or without BMP during surgery. METHODS 57 patients who have undergone surgery for pyogenic spondylodiscitis after presenting to a tertiary Spine referral institution between 2011 and 2020 were included. 18 underwent surgery alone without BMP and 39 underwent surgery with BMP. Outcomes were compared between the two groups, including re-operations, infection recurrences, BMP- related complications and radiological fusion. RESULTS The cohort comprised 41 males (71.9%) with a mean age 63.7 +/- 13.3 years. Surgical indications include instability (n = 18), pain (n = 4), neurological deficit (n = 15) and sepsis or failure of non-operative management (n = 20). In the group who underwent surgery without BMP, there were two cases of re-operation for infection recurrence (11.1%) and three cases of cage subsidence; 80% achieved definitive and probable fusion. In the group who underwent surgery with BMP, there were three cases of re-operation for infection recurrence (7.7%), three cases of cage subsidence and one case of BMP- related radiculitis; 96.5% achieved definitive and probable fusion. CONCLUSIONS The use of BMP in the surgical treatment of pyogenic spondylodiscitis did not confer an increased risk of infection recurrence, revision surgery or radiculitis. BMP can be a useful and safe adjunct in surgical intervention for pyogenic spondylodiscitis.

Implementation of a multidisciplinary infections conference improves the treatment of spondylodiscitis. Sci Rep 2021; 11:9515. Abstract
Establishing a multidisciplinary approach regarding the treatment of spondylodiscitis and analyzing its effect compared to a single discipline approach. 361 patients diagnosed with spondylodiscitis were included in this retrospective pre-post intervention study. The treatment strategy was either established by a single discipline approach (n = 149, year 2003–2011) or by a weekly multidisciplinary infections conference (n = 212, year 2013–2018) consisting of at least an orthopedic surgeon, medical microbiologist, infectious disease specialist and pathologist. Recorded data included the surgical and antibiotic strategy, complications leading to operative revision, recovered microorganisms, as well as the total length of hospital and intensive care unit stay. Compared to a single discipline approach, performing the multidisciplinary infections conference led to significant changes in anti-infective and surgical treatment strategies. Patients discussed in the conference showed significantly reduced days of total antibiotic treatment (66 ± 31 vs 104 ± 31, p < 0.001). Moreover, one stage procedures and open transpedicular screw placement were more frequently performed following multidisciplinary discussions, while there were less involved spinal segments in terms of internal fixation as well as an increased use of intervertebral cages instead of autologous bone graft (p < 0.001). Staphylococcus aureus and Staphylococcus epidermidis were the most frequently recovered organisms in both patient groups. No significant difference was found comparing inpatient complications between the two groups or the total in-hospital stay. Implementation of a weekly infections conference is an effective approach to introduce multidisciplinarity into spondylodiscitis management. These conferences significantly altered the treatment plan compared to a single discipline approach. Therefore, we highly recommend the implementation to optimize treatment modalities for patients.
